The problem

Where barbershop sites fall short.

01

One booking link for the whole shop

Clients book a barber, not a business. Without per-barber links, a regular has to hunt through a scheduler to find the only person they'll sit for.

02

No walk-in information

Half your traffic is deciding whether to drive over right now. Walk-in policy, busiest hours and current wait expectations belong at the top of the page.

03

Prices missing

Cut, beard, hot towel shave, kids, line-up, colour. These are small, comparable numbers and hiding them just sends someone to a shop that lists them.

04

Cut gallery buried or absent

Fades, tapers, designs and beard work are the portfolio. If it only lives on Instagram, search engines and first-time clients never see it.

05

No shop personality

Barbershops are one of the last genuinely social businesses. A grey template throws away the exact thing that makes people loyal.

06

Weak local search presence

'Barber near me' and neighbourhood searches are almost the entire acquisition channel. Without structured data and local pages, you're invisible in it.
